Contents

H3K27M diffuse intrinsic pontine gliomas (DIPG) exhibit cellular heterogeneity comprising less-differentiated, stem-like glioma cells that resemble oligodendrocyte precursors (OPC) and more differentiated astrocyte (AC)-like cells.
